
Introduction to CEBL
The Canadian Elite Basketball League (CEBL) has emerged as a pivotal platform for basketball in Canada since its founding in 2017. With a focus on providing a professional environment for Canadian players and a thrilling experience for fans, the CEBL has quickly gained recognition and importance in the sports landscape. Amidst a backdrop of increasing international interest in basketball, the CEBL offers a unique blend of local talent and competitive play.
